Why AI matters at this scale
West Memphis Public Schools, a mid-sized Arkansas district serving a diverse student population, operates with 201–500 employees. At this scale, the district faces a classic resource paradox: enough complexity to need sophisticated solutions, but limited capacity to build them in-house. AI offers a bridge—automating routine tasks, personalizing learning, and surfacing actionable insights without requiring a large data science team.
The district’s current landscape
Like many public school systems, WMPS relies on a patchwork of legacy systems: a student information system (likely PowerSchool), learning management tools (Canvas or Google Classroom), and productivity suites (Google Workspace or Microsoft 365). Data often sits in silos, and teachers spend hours on grading, attendance, and parent communication. Meanwhile, student needs vary widely, and early warning signs of disengagement can be missed. AI can connect these dots.
Three concrete AI opportunities with ROI
1. Personalized learning at scale
Adaptive platforms like DreamBox or Khan Academy’s AI tutor can serve as a 1:1 math or reading coach for every student, adjusting difficulty in real time. For a district with 3,000–5,000 students, this could lift proficiency rates by 5–10 percentage points within two years, directly impacting state accountability metrics and potentially attracting additional funding.
2. Teacher time reclamation through automation
AI grading tools (e.g., Gradescope, Turnitin’s AI) can cut grading time by 30–50%. For a teacher with 150 students, that’s 3–5 hours saved per week—time redirected to small-group instruction or relationship building. Multiply across 200+ teachers, and the district gains the equivalent of several full-time positions without hiring.
3. Operational efficiency and cost savings
AI-driven scheduling can reduce bus route miles by 10–15%, saving fuel and maintenance costs. Chatbots handling routine parent inquiries (school closures, lunch menus, enrollment steps) can reduce front-office call volume by 40%, freeing staff for more complex issues. These savings can be reinvested in instructional technology.
Deployment risks specific to this size band
Mid-sized districts often lack a dedicated IT project manager, so vendor selection and change management become critical. Without careful planning, AI tools can become shelfware. Data privacy is paramount—FERPA and state laws require strict controls. Start with a pilot in one school or grade level, using a vendor that offers robust onboarding and support. Engage teachers early as co-designers, not just end-users, to build trust and ensure tools fit real classroom workflows. Finally, measure impact with clear KPIs (e.g., time saved, student growth percentiles) to justify continued investment.

6 agent deployments worth exploring for west memphis public schools
AI Tutoring and Adaptive Learning
Integrate adaptive platforms that adjust content difficulty in real time, providing personalized math and reading support for every student.
Automated Grading and Feedback
Use AI to grade assignments and essays, giving instant feedback to students and freeing teachers for higher-value instruction.
Predictive Early Warning System
Analyze attendance, grades, and behavior data to flag at-risk students early, enabling timely interventions.
AI-Powered Administrative Chatbots
Deploy chatbots on the district website and parent portal to answer FAQs about enrollment, calendars, and policies 24/7.
Intelligent Scheduling and Resource Optimization
Use AI to optimize class schedules, bus routes, and substitute teacher placements, reducing costs and conflicts.
Professional Development Recommendation Engine
Leverage AI to suggest personalized PD courses for teachers based on classroom performance data and career goals.
